Magnesium fluorosilicate

Description:
Magnesium fluorosilicate, with the CAS number 16949-65-8, is an inorganic compound that typically appears as a white crystalline solid. It is composed of magnesium, fluorine, silicon, and oxygen, and is often used in various industrial applications, including as a flux in metallurgy and as a component in ceramics and glass manufacturing. The compound is known for its ability to enhance the properties of materials, such as improving thermal stability and chemical resistance. Magnesium fluorosilicate is generally considered to be stable under normal conditions, but it can release toxic fluorine-containing gases when subjected to high temperatures or reactive environments. It is important to handle this substance with care, as it can pose health risks if inhaled or ingested, and appropriate safety measures should be taken to minimize exposure. Additionally, its solubility in water is limited, which can affect its behavior in environmental contexts. Overall, magnesium fluorosilicate is a versatile compound with specific applications in various fields, particularly in materials science.
